Index: ssts-web/src/main/webapp/disinfectsystem/basedatamanager/tousse/idCardInstanceView.js =================================================================== diff -u -r36430 -r37471 --- ssts-web/src/main/webapp/disinfectsystem/basedatamanager/tousse/idCardInstanceView.js (.../idCardInstanceView.js) (revision 36430) +++ ssts-web/src/main/webapp/disinfectsystem/basedatamanager/tousse/idCardInstanceView.js (.../idCardInstanceView.js) (revision 37471) @@ -41,6 +41,8 @@ $Id('parm_s_firstRecyclingTimeEnd').value = Ext.getCmp('firstRecyclingTimeEnd').getRawValue(); $Id('parm_s_lostDateStart').value = Ext.getCmp('lostDateStart').getRawValue(); $Id('parm_s_lostDateEnd').value = Ext.getCmp('lostDateEnd').getRawValue(); + $Id('parm_s_lastInvoiceDateStart').value = Ext.getCmp('lastInvoiceDateStart').getRawValue(); + $Id('parm_s_lastInvoiceDateEnd').value = Ext.getCmp('lastInvoiceDateEnd').getRawValue(); $Id('parm_s_instrumentSetTypeIds').value = Ext.getCmp('instrumentSetTypeIds').getValue(); $Id('parm_s_isDisable').value = isDisable; grid.dwrReload(); @@ -157,6 +159,7 @@ { header: "使用次数", width: 80, dataIndex: 'useAmount' }, { header: "标识牌编号", width: 100, dataIndex: 'idNumber' }, { header: "位置", width: 100, dataIndex: 'locationForDisplay' }, + { header: "最后发货时间", width: 170, dataIndex: 'lastInvoiceTime', renderer: myDateFormatBySecond }, { header: "最后打印时间", width: 170, dataIndex: 'printDate', renderer: myDateFormatBySecond }, { header: "第一次回收时间", width: 170, dataIndex: 'firstRecyclingTime', renderer: myDateFormatBySecond }, { header: "丢失时间", width: 170, dataIndex: 'lostDate', renderer: myDateFormatBySecond } @@ -174,6 +177,7 @@ { name: 'printDate' }, { name: 'idCardDefinitionID' }, { name: 'firstRecyclingTime' }, + { name: 'lastInvoiceTime' }, { name: 'lostDate' } ]; @@ -340,6 +344,8 @@ store: new Ext.data.SimpleStore({ fields: ['tousseStatus'], data: [['全部'], + ['清洗中'], + ['已清洗'], ['已装配'], ['已审核'], ['已灭菌'], @@ -504,6 +510,35 @@ }, { columnWidth: .25, layout: 'form', + items: [{ + xtype: 'datefieldWithMin', + fieldLabel: '最后发货时间', + id: 'lastInvoiceDateStart', + name: 'lastInvoiceDateStart', + editable: false, + format: 'Y-m-d H:i', + altFormats: 'Y-m-d|Y-n-j|y-n-j|y-m-j|y-m-d|y-n-d|Y-n-d|Y-m-j|Ymd|Ynj|ynj|ymj|ymd|ynd|Ynd|Ymj|Y/m/d|Y/n/j|y/n/j|y/m/j|y/m/d|y/n/d|Y/n/d|Y/m/j', + anchor: '95%' + }] + }, { + columnWidth: .25, + layout: 'form', + labelWidth: 30, + labelAlign: 'left', + items: [{ + xtype: 'datefieldWithMin', + fieldLabel: '至', + labelSeparator: '', + id: 'lastInvoiceDateEnd', + name: 'lastInvoiceDateEnd', + editable: false, + format: 'Y-m-d H:i', + altFormats: 'Y-m-d|Y-n-j|y-n-j|y-m-j|y-m-d|y-n-d|Y-n-d|Y-m-j|Ymd|Ynj|ynj|ymj|ymd|ynd|Ynd|Ymj|Y/m/d|Y/n/j|y/n/j|y/m/j|y/m/d|y/n/d|Y/n/d|Y/m/j', + anchor: '95%' + }] + }, { + columnWidth: .25, + layout: 'form', hidden:!sstsConfig.enableInstrumentSetTypeSetting, items: [{ xtype:'hidden', @@ -558,6 +593,8 @@ $Id('firstRecyclingTimeEnd').value = ""; $Id('lostDateStart').value = ""; $Id('lostDateEnd').value = ""; + $Id('lastInvoiceDateStart').value = ""; + $Id('lastInvoiceDateEnd').value = ""; Ext.getCmp('assetsBelongCode').setValue(''); Ext.getCmp('IDCardStatus').setValue('全部'); } Index: ssts-web/src/main/webapp/disinfectsystem/basedatamanager/tousse/idCardInstanceView.jsp =================================================================== diff -u -r36430 -r37471 --- ssts-web/src/main/webapp/disinfectsystem/basedatamanager/tousse/idCardInstanceView.jsp (.../idCardInstanceView.jsp) (revision 36430) +++ ssts-web/src/main/webapp/disinfectsystem/basedatamanager/tousse/idCardInstanceView.jsp (.../idCardInstanceView.jsp) (revision 37471) @@ -97,6 +97,8 @@ + +